    I have just had a service and MOT ( a week apart) and I still can't believe that my front brake pads are the orginal ones.

    I have covered 86,000 miles in 3 years (from new) in my Touran 2.0TDi Sport and still the front pads are only 70% worn according the the VW dealer that serviced the car or 50% worn according to the MOT garage in my village.

    Unless the VW dealer replaced them without telling me or charging me a while back then they are doing well!!

    Admittingly alot of the miles are motorway, but these days motorway driving involves hitting the brakes hard when suddenly the brake lights in front go on. Stop start all the time (70mph to 10mph to 70 mph etc. etc)

    I have to say the Touran may be a bit dull (though the sport model with sports suspension in maui blue - which is mine! looks good) but it is built to last, has a good spec on it and hasn't cost much to run. Variable service every 18k or so, timming belt at 80K and tyres when needed. thats it!!!

    I am selling it now though as a company car beckons, so I will be sorry to see it go but hope my next car (likley to be a VW or Audi) will be as good.
